Indulge your senses in the heart of Kyoto at Kiten Ya, where authentic Japanese tempura takes center stage. Opting for exclusively counter seating, this cozy gem invites diners to witness the art of frying firsthand. With each crunch, you're treated to the genuine essence of pristine ingredients like succulent shrimp and crispy seasonal vegetables, elevating dining to an immersive experience. Just minutes from Shijo Karasuma Station, Kiten Ya stands as a calming retreat amidst urban bustle, perfect for intimate gatherings or celebratory indulgences. Led by a chef devoted to precision, every bite at Kiten Ya narrates a story of culinary tradition and contemporary flair. Delight in a unique sensory journey with every visit.
